首页
学习
活动
专区
工具
TVP
发布

弹性云—腾讯云弹性伸缩

当业务规模蓬勃增长,面对数以万计请求量,庞大业务流量,高并发数据访问量,仅靠人工看守,时刻准备着当“救火员”,哪儿有问题冲向哪儿,是不可能事情。...腾讯云自动调度系统—弹性伸缩震撼来袭,能自动发现异常,帮助业务容量自动伸缩,协助故障自动愈合,用程序解决人工很难解决问题。...弹性伸缩组中云主机处于非健康状态时,若一台云主机长期发现ping不可达,则系统会自动判断出该云主机异常,创建新实例替换非健康状态旧实例,保证伸缩组对外正常提供服务。 3....二、弹性伸缩4大功能 1. 定时伸缩 在指定时间内根据预先配置,自动生产或销毁云服务器,除了设置一次性操作外,还可设置周期性重复定时任务。帮助您周期性业务变化自动调整业务容量,省去人工看守成本。...实现弹性自动发现异常,自动愈合能力。 弹性云,可靠云 弹性是云计算技术中公认从资源利用角度最重要特点之一。弹性主要特性是按需增减计算、存储、网络等各种资源。

9.6K20

云计算弹性伸缩概念是什么?弹性伸缩有什么优势?

其实我们之前对云计算弹性伸缩概念做过一些介绍,但仍然有很多朋友对它概念不是很清楚。其实要理解云计算弹性伸缩并不困难,我们需要先弄清这么两个问题:云计算弹性伸缩概念是什么?弹性伸缩有什么优势?...云计算弹性伸缩概念是什么? 弹性伸缩其实是一项自动调节计算资源功能,它会根据我们业务需要和伸缩要求来进行调整。用户可以自定义设置监控策略,也可以设置定时或者是周期。...弹性伸缩可以根据需要来调节增加CVM实例数量,从而确保计算性能不会受到什么影响。如果需求比较低时候,CVM实例数量也会相应减少,这当然可以为用户节约很多成本。 弹性伸缩有什么优势?...实例健康状况会受到弹性伸缩检测,确保计算容量合理性。 云计算弹性伸缩概念是什么?弹性伸缩有什么优势?关于这两个问题,就先介绍到这里,希望能够为大家提供实实在在帮助。...当然,弹性伸缩功能和重要性远不止这些,大家可以对它进行深入了解。

4.1K20
您找到你想要的搜索结果了吗?
是的
没有找到

云计算弹性伸缩作用什么技术?云计算弹性伸缩优点有哪些?

云计算弹性伸缩可以说是现在大势所趋,特别是对于视频类企业来说是刚需,也是互联网在工作和生活中应用产物。那么云计算弹性伸缩作用什么技术?云计算弹性伸缩优点有哪些?...云计算弹性伸缩作用什么技术 云计算关键技术是弹性伸缩控制技术,是通过对系统适应负载变化进行合适调控一项技术。弹性伸缩有纵向和横向伸缩两种,纵向弹性伸缩是通过增加主机配置来实现,但扩展性有限。...2、自动化处理问题:通过应用多种伸缩模式和策略,应对于不同适应场景,节约人工成本同时,还能提高工作效率和出错率。...3、自带容错能力:当弹性伸缩主机处于非健康工作状态时,系统会自动判断主机异常,同时做出相应对应策略,以保证云主机能对外正常提供服务。...4、节约成本,提高效率:使用云计算弹性伸缩后,很多方面就不用人工做预判和处理了,同时还比人工处理效率高,能及时发现并解决问题。 云计算弹性伸缩作用什么技术?

5.5K10

挖掘Kubernetes 弹性伸缩:水平 Pod 自动扩展全部潜力

Kubernetes 一项基本功能是其弹性伸缩功能,它允许应用程序根据工作负载和性能指标进行扩展或缩减。...Kubernetes 中弹性伸缩弹性伸缩是现代容器编排系统一项关键功能,使应用程序能够根据需求和性能指标自动调整其资源。这种动态扩展使系统能够保持最佳性能和效率,同时最大限度地降低运营成本。...弹性伸缩优点:弹性伸缩在维护高效且有弹性系统方面提供了许多好处,包括: 资源优化:自动扩展可确保您应用程序使用适量资源来满足其性能要求,从而降低过度配置或配置不足风险。...Kubernetes 中水平 Pod 弹性伸缩 (HPA) Kubernetes 中 Horizontal Pod Autoscaler(HPA)基本工作机制涉及监控、伸缩策略和 Kubernetes...它从每个节点上 kubelet 收集数据,并向 HPA 和其他需要资源使用信息组件提供指标。

35831

k8s多维度自动弹性伸缩

一、背景1.1 什么是弹性伸缩根据用户业务需求和策略,自动调整其弹性计算资源管理服务,其优势有:从应用开发者角度:能够让应用程序开发者专注实现业务功能,无需过多考虑系统层资源从系统运维者角度:极大降低运维负担..., 如果系统设计合理可以实现“零运维”从管理者角度:极大降低成本是实现 Serverless 架构基石,也是 Serverless 主要特性之一1.2 k8s 自动弹性伸缩功能包括Pod 水平自动伸缩...,HPA,Horizontal Pod AutoscalerPod 垂直自动伸缩,VPA,Vertical Pod Autoscaler集群自动伸缩,CA,Cluster Autoscaler。...是最常用弹性伸缩组件解决是业务负载波动较大问题依赖 metrics-server 组件收集 pod 上 metrics,然后根据预先设定伸缩策略决定扩缩容 podmetrics-server...,自动计算或调整资源配额VPA-Controller 需要额外安装,参考1.5 CA负责调整 k8s node 节点数量实现集群级别的扩缩容依赖底层 IaaS 层弹性伸缩能力CA-Controller

1.4K10

k8s多维度自动弹性伸缩

一、背景 1.1 什么是弹性伸缩 根据用户业务需求和策略,自动调整其弹性计算资源管理服务,其优势有: 从应用开发者角度:能够让应用程序开发者专注实现业务功能,无需过多考虑系统层资源 从系统运维者角度...:极大降低运维负担, 如果系统设计合理可以实现“零运维” 从管理者角度:极大降低成本 是实现 Serverless 架构基石,也是 Serverless 主要特性之一 1.2 k8s 自动弹性伸缩功能包括...Pod 水平自动伸缩,HPA,Horizontal Pod Autoscaler Pod 垂直自动伸缩,VPA,Vertical Pod Autoscaler 集群自动伸缩,CA,Cluster Autoscaler...是最常用弹性伸缩组件 解决是业务负载波动较大问题 依赖 metrics-server 组件收集 pod 上 metrics,然后根据预先设定伸缩策略决定扩缩容 pod metrics-server...依赖历史负载指标,自动计算或调整资源配额 VPA-Controller 需要额外安装,参考 1.5 CA 负责调整 k8s node 节点数量实现集群级别的扩缩容 依赖底层 IaaS 层弹性伸缩能力

1.7K20

应对MySQL弹性伸缩带来挑战

数据弹性伸缩与WebServer相比,复杂了很多倍,对于WebServer弹性伸缩直接用负载均衡+弹性伸缩组件搞定。但对于数据扩容、缩容将面临数据不一致等问题。...这些问题在互联网企业上云是必须解决,为提升我们对大型业务上云理解,我们今天一起来看一看。 ? 一、数据弹性伸缩究竟会出现什么问题?...传统公司习惯对数据库进行垂直伸缩,他们购买更强大服务器,增加更多内存,换更快更大磁盘,期望数据库引擎能够利用这些资源实现伸缩。...数据伸缩主要问题是,服务器是有数据业务,是重有状态化数据,增加、删除服务器都会对数据访问带来直接影响。例如:因数据量下降,自动删除一台数据库服务器,而上面有数据该怎么办?...但写服务器只有一台,还是会遇到数据处理能力上限。 主主同步:此时各服务器之间关系是同等,主用1写入一条数据,主用2自动也同步写入该数据,反之亦然。

1.9K20

Fluid 给数据弹性一双隐形翅膀 -- 自定义弹性伸缩

导读:弹性伸缩作为 Kubernetes 核心能力之一,但它一直是围绕这无状态应用负载展开。而 Fluid 提供了分布式缓存弹性伸缩能力,可以灵活扩充和收缩数据缓存。...弹性伸缩作为 Kubernetes 核心能力之一,但它一直是围绕这无状态应用负载展开。而 Fluid 提供了分布式缓存弹性伸缩能力,可以灵活扩充和收缩数据缓存。...弹性伸缩条件是当已有缓存数据量达到一定比例时,就会触发弹性扩容,扩容缓存空间。...此时可以发现缓存数据量接近了 Fluid 可以提供缓存能力(1GiB)同时触发了弹性伸缩条件。...总结 Fluid 提供了结合 Prometheous,Kubernetes HPA 和 Custom Metrics 能力,根据占用缓存空间比例触发自动弹性伸缩能力,实现缓存能力按需使用。

93030

基于 Armory 进行 Kubernetes 集群弹性伸缩

作者 | Michael Bogan 译者 | Luga Lee 策划 | Luga Lee 基于不同 Kubernetes 集群弹性伸缩方案,在日常维护中具有重要意义 ~ 想象一下,假设亚马逊每年只有一天不可用...一旦我们添加了一个简单现实,即应用程序和自动化系统也需要它们自己权限来混合,问题就复杂了。 归根结底,这种规模管理是不可能通过单击某些 Web 控制台中按钮来实现。...整个过程必须是动态,在整个企业中具有自动发现和一致指导原则。 操作环境 现在,让我们更详细地了解全球大规模系统一个方面。每个工作负载并不存在于单个环境中。...如果我们集群运行在云提供商和私有数据中心混合上,这又增加了复杂性另一个维度。...升级过程分为两部分:升级控制平面和升级数据平面(工作节点)。数据平面版本是指安装在每个节点上 Kubernetes 组件版本(Kubelet、容器运行时、Kube 代理)。

86050

云计算弹性伸缩是什么意思?云计算弹性伸缩应用场景有哪些?

云计算已经成了IT行业标配了,只要有使用到IT公司都会用到云计算。而云计算弹性伸缩也非常受IT行业欢迎。那么云计算弹性伸缩是什么意思?云计算弹性伸缩应用场景有哪些?...云计算弹性伸缩是什么意思 云计算弹性伸缩目前有两种:分别是横向弹性伸缩和绷向弹性伸缩。...横向弹性伸缩具有很强扩展性,而纵向弹性伸缩扩展性没有横向弹性伸缩强,比较配置不可能无限制增加。云计算弹性伸缩是可以自行调控使用哪种弹性伸缩。...云计算弹性伸缩应用场景有哪些 1、购物类网站:像大型购物网站,到购物活动时候,用户访问量会巨增,这时可以使用弹性伸缩定时伸缩功能,可将需要弹性伸缩时间段设置好。...综上所述,云计算弹性伸缩是什么情况下都可以使用,不仅为企业节约了人工成本,还能提高企业业务工作效率,同时还具有自动修复和愈合有功能,一举多得。

4.1K10

一文搞懂使用 KEDA 实现 Kubernetes 自动弹性伸缩

与传统静态基础设施不同,现代云原生解决方案提供了更加灵活和自动弹性伸缩能力。通过运用容器化技术和编排工具,如 Kubernetes,我们可以根据负载需求变化自动进行伸缩,实现资源弹性调配。...如果底层基础设施无法满足自动扩缩容需求,例如,底层节点资源有限或网络带宽不足,那么自动弹性伸缩效果将受到限制。 4....KEDA 出现填补了这一缺失,通过引入事件驱动自动弹性伸缩机制,使得在 Kubernetes 上运行事件驱动应用程序可以更加高效地扩展。...Server 充当 KEDA 和 Kubernetes 之间集成桥梁,将 KEDA 自动弹性伸缩功能与 Kubernetes 资源管理功能相结合。...3、Controller 和 Scaler 负责根据 Metrics Adapter 收集指标来进行自动弹性伸缩。Controller 负责将弹性任务发送给 Scaler。

66820

基于事件驱动Kubernetes弹性伸缩工具keda

behavior scaleDown: stabilizationWindowSeconds: 300 # 等待 5 分钟再开始缩容,防止业务抖动导致频繁伸缩...: 'components.worker.tasks'暂停自动扩缩,如果您想进行集群维护或希望通过删除非关键任务工作负载来避免资源匮乏,指示 KEDA 暂停对象自动缩放可能很有用。...value: 1 # 每次扩容只新增 1 个 Pod禁止自动缩容希望扩容后不自动缩容,需要人工干预或其它自己开发 controller 来判断缩容条件,可以使用类型如下 behavior 配置来禁止自动缩容...stabilizationWindowSeconds: 600 # 等待 10 分钟再开始缩容 policies: - type: pods value: 5 # 每次只缩掉 5 个 Pod延长扩容时间窗口有些应用经常会有数据毛刺导致频繁扩容...部署KEDA自动伸缩针对kafka消费产生堆积情况进行伸缩

1.3K70

云计算弹性和可伸缩性区别在哪里?云计算弹性伸缩是什么意思?

可是,不同公司对于云计算要求也是不一样。怎样可以实现这些呢?这就需要从云计算弹性伸缩开始讲解了。那么云计算弹性和可伸缩性区别在哪里?云计算弹性伸缩是什么意思?...云计算弹性伸缩是什么意思 云计算弹性伸缩就是可弹性伸缩,云计算弹性伸缩分为两种,即横向弹性伸缩和纵向弹性伸缩。...横向弹性伸缩主要是扩展性强,也就相当于云计算中伸缩意思,可以将实例资源整合后无限抽伸缩。纵向弹性伸缩也就相当于云计算中弹性意思,可定义伸缩时间。...两者相结合从而实现了云计算强大弹性伸缩功能。 云计算弹性和可伸缩性区别在哪里 其实云计算具有弹性伸缩功能,是将弹性和可伸缩结合在一起使用。...只有将两者相结合,才能实现云计算自动弹性伸缩功能。并且云计算弹性伸缩还具有自我调控能力,通过自我调控来减少人工操作成本,提高企业业务工作效率。

4.4K10

弹性伸缩:云如何提供巨大推动力

弹性伸缩介绍 弹性伸缩是许多云计算服务中一个强大功能,它允许根据在特定时间发生负载来增加或减少资源。...但是,现在许多其他云服务厂商也提供此功能,因此您有多种选择可供选择,以最大限度地满足贵公司需求。 弹性伸缩如何工作 弹性伸缩对处理流量峰值和低谷都是有利。...通过自动调节,额外资源只在需要时候才会被使用,例如,您不必为了处理在某个时间点高负载而使用额外服务器。相反,你只需在需要时候付钱,这可能会给你省下不少钱!...通过弹性伸缩,意外流量峰值将会被自动处理,从而有助于避免停机。...他们用来满足需求第一项技术是AWS提供Amazon Auto Scaling(AAS 亚马逊弹性伸缩)。对于AAS,Netflix对弹性伸缩功能有效性给予了很高评价。

1.7K80

EMQX Operator 如何快速创建弹性伸缩 MQTT 集群

作为积极拥抱云原生大规模分布式开源物联网 MQTT 消息服务器,EMQX 最新发布 5.0 版本采用了新后端存储架构 Mria 数据库,并重构了数据复制逻辑,增加了 Replicant 节点角色,...使用户可以摆脱有状态节点限制,对 EMQX 集群进行更加弹性水平扩展,打造更加符合云原生理念物联网应用。...本文将通过对 EMQX Kubernetes Operator 核心特性及应用实操详细讲解,帮助读者进一步掌握如何快速创建部署及自动化管理可弹性伸缩 EMQX 集群,充分利用 EMQX 5.0 对云原生支持特性...它是一个用于自动化部署、扩展和管理容器化应用程序广泛使用开源平台。...用户可以通过修改 EMQX 自定义资源快速伸缩 Replicant 节点数量,更灵活地处理自己业务。

1K30

云计算弹性伸缩是什么意思?它作用有哪些?

这里我们就来讲讲云计算弹性伸缩是什么意思?它作用有哪些? 云计算弹性伸缩是什么意思 云计算弹性伸缩意思就是,通过应用云计算弹性伸缩功能实现业务量增减资源合理应用。...也就是说,当我们在某一时间段需要增加业务量时,云计算弹性伸缩就会自动增加所需要资源,而当不再需要增加业务量时,它就又会自动减少相应资源需求。以达到对资源合理利用,提高效率,节约成本。...弹性伸缩分为横向弹性伸缩和纵向弹性伸缩两种。两种相互应用,互相搭配,可更好应用于云计算服务中。 云计算弹性伸缩作用有哪些 1、通过对某一时间段进行预先配置,实现定时配置功能。...这个需要人为提前预判业务量,然后再根据时间段来配置。 2、根据云服务器内部CPU,内存利用率,以及内网出入带宽来自动进行增加或减少云服务器实例方式,实现自动智能伸缩。...当业务出现异常时,可第一时间发现并自动解决相关故障。 3、因云计算可弹性伸缩功能,可自动修复与处理问题,从而节约了运维的人工成本,同时还提高了效率。

4.5K20

实用教程丨使用自定义指标进行K8s自动弹性伸缩

Kubernetes自动弹性伸缩可以根据业务流量,自动增加或减少服务。这一功能在实际业务场景中十分重要。在本文中,我们将了解Kubernetes如何针对应用产生自定义指标实现自动伸缩。 ?...Metric server仅提供核心指标,比如pod和节点内存和CPU,对于其他指标,你需要构建完整指标流水线。构建流水线和Kubernetes自动伸缩机制将会保持不变。...Demo:Kubernetes自动伸缩 我们将演示如何使用自定义指标自动伸缩应用程序,并且借助Prometheus和Prometheus adapter。...Kubernetes自动伸缩实践 一旦你根据下文中步骤进行,指标值会不断增加。...在过去几个版本中,Kubernetes中监控流水线已经大有发展,而Kubernetes自动伸缩主要基于该流水线工作。如果你不熟悉这个环境,很容易感到困惑和迷茫。

1.1K20

云原生弹性 AI 训练系列之三:借助弹性伸缩 Jupyter Notebook,大幅提高 GPU 利用率

高策,腾讯高级工程师,Kubeflow 训练和自动机器学习工作组 Tech Lead,负责腾讯云 TKE 在 AI 场景产品研发和支持工作。...Jupyter Notebooks 是目前应用最为广泛交互式开发环境,它很好地满足了数据科学、深度学习模型构建等场景代码开发需求。...不过 Jupyter Notebooks 在方便了算法工程师和数据科学家们日常开发工作同时,也对基础架构提出了更多挑战。 资源利用率问题 最大挑战来自于 GPU 资源利用率。...创建完这两个资源后,就可以体验到弹性伸缩 Jupyter Notebook 了。如果在一个小时内一直没有使用的话,Kernel 会被回收。 $ kubectl apply -f ....往期精选推荐   云原生弹性 AI 训练系列之一:基于 AllReduce 弹性分布式训练实践 云原生弹性 AI 训练系列之二:PyTorch 1.9.0 弹性分布式训练设计与实现 云原生

99720
领券